Transaction 75d946fe6b4dd23f33d71211fde50c348699a885b1bf4fb46a4e7da4e5205c62
2 Input
2 Outputs
- 75d946fe6b4dd23f33d71211fde50c348699a885b1bf4fb46a4e7da4e5205c62:0
- 75d946fe6b4dd23f33d71211fde50c348699a885b1bf4fb46a4e7da4e5205c62:1
value 3985511
address 1GHSWYuFHCFWCvTCQ3YX6cB6YSdLiM5yWs
value 20898325
address 1U81JRUEFiRwk6cyatedV9ETDxtbXMP9J